(1) Fundamentals of measurement
- Human physiology: cardiovascular and respiratory systems, heart bumps, pulmonary circulation, oxygen/co2 transport and exchange, arterial and venous blood, blood volume changes, etc.
- Skin optics: skin composition and structure, light penetration depth into skin, light interactions with skin tissues and absorbers (scattering and absorption), skin reflection, wavelength dependency, etc.
(2) Measurement setups and methods:
- Camera setups: multi-cameras system, RGB2NIR (dual-band), low-light cameras, thermal cameras
- Light source unit: broad-band illumination LED
- Reference: contact-PPG/ECG, CO2 capno, human annotations
- Measured signs/activities: heart rate (DIS, CNN), breathing rate (Color/2D ProCor), posture from physiological measurement, thermal classification on breathing patterns, patient comfort/discomfort classification, etc.
